在数字时代,技术发展的步伐不断加快,无代码平台应运而生,为那些没有编程背景的人提供了创造数字产品的机会。那么,无代码平台究竟是什么?它与传统的编程有何不同?本文将带你深入了解无代码平台的奥秘。
什么是无代码平台?
无代码平台,顾名思义,是一种不需要编写代码即可构建应用程序的工具。它通过图形化界面、拖放组件和模板等直观的方式,让用户能够快速搭建出各种功能的应用程序。这些平台通常提供丰富的模块和组件,涵盖前端界面、后端逻辑、数据库操作等多个方面。
无代码平台的特点
- 易用性:无代码平台降低了技术门槛,即使是没有任何编程经验的人也能轻松上手。
- 灵活性:尽管无需编写代码,但无代码平台仍然提供了丰富的功能和定制选项。
- 快速迭代:用户可以快速构建原型,并根据用户反馈进行迭代改进。
- 成本效益:由于无需专业的编程人员,无代码平台可以降低开发成本。
无代码平台与传统编程的区别
技术门槛
- 无代码平台:对编程知识要求较低,用户可以通过直观的操作完成应用开发。
- 传统编程:需要掌握一定的编程语言和开发工具,对技术能力要求较高。
开发速度
- 无代码平台:开发周期短,可以快速搭建原型和应用。
- 传统编程:开发周期较长,需要编写和调试大量的代码。
成本
- 无代码平台:开发成本较低,无需专业的编程人员。
- 传统编程:开发成本较高,需要投入大量的人力、物力和财力。
功能复杂度
- 无代码平台:适合构建功能相对简单的应用。
- 传统编程:可以开发功能复杂、性能要求高的应用。
无代码平台的适用场景
- 快速原型设计:用于验证业务想法,降低前期投入。
- 中小型应用开发:如网站、移动应用、内部管理系统等。
- 业务流程自动化:如审批流程、数据采集等。
总结
无代码平台的出现,为数字时代的发展带来了新的机遇。它让更多的人参与到应用开发中来,降低了技术门槛,提高了开发效率。然而,无代码平台并不能完全取代传统编程,两者各有优劣,应根据实际需求选择合适的技术路线。
